Fundamental and Derived Physical Quantities WebArea density. The area density (also known as areal density, surface density, superficial density, areic density, mass thickness, column density, or density thickness) of a two-dimensional object is calculated as the mass per unit area. The SI derived unit is the kilogram per square metre (kg·m −2 ). A related area number density can be ... jesse lopez photography https://ghitamusic.com

It is an ideal (baseline) physical constant. Its CODATA value is: ε0 = 8.854 187 8128(13) × 10−12 F⋅m−1 ( farads per meter ), with a relative uncertainty of 1.5 × 10−10.
